Subject: Re: [PATCH v4 next 5/6] iio: sca3000: stop interrupts via devm_add_action_or_reset()
Date: Wed, 4 Feb 2026 14:52:14 +0530	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<934cfc72-b17a-47e8-8a5e-2dd63a3a3655@oracle.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<aYMK06VJUrXCnNiX@smile.fi.intel.com>

Hi Andy,

On 04/02/26 14:31, Andy Shevchenko wrote:
> On Tue, Feb 03, 2026 at 10:12:00PM -0800, Harshit Mogalapalli wrote:
>> sca3000_stop_all_interrupts() is moved above the probe routine so the
>> new function sca3000_disable_interrupts() used in probe can directly
>> call it without additional declaration.
>>
>> Used devm_add_action_or_reset() for shutting down the interrupts.
>> Make sca3000_stop_all_interrupts() return void now that it always hooks
>> into devm cleanup.
>>
>> No functional change intended.
> 
> This patch overloaded by extra thing. What you should do is just move code
> upper without _any_ modifications being done _before_ even patching it for
> guard()(). With that additional patch the rest will look much easier to
> review.
> 

I agree, thanks a lot for the suggestions!
